When can you start introducing finger food. I let my 8 month old try a bit of our marmite on bread the other day and she was sooo enthusiastic. Got me thinkig. What other good finger foods could I use?
 
My son loves vegemite on his toast too, just watch the sodium levels at that age though. You can also try steaming various veggies and serving them cool with dips - try hommus (very nutricious) or home-maked guacamole or even yoghurt or cream cheese...you can do the same with toast!
 
I think brown/wholemeal is generally better but have to watch out for salt content/sodium and additives..

My baby (now 14 months) never liked me feeding her, she preferred to feed herself. At 8 months I would toast the bread. Fresh bread can get a bit chewy/lumpy which is hard when you have no teeth.

My bub also liked any soft fruit cut up (watermelon, strawberries, blueberries, bananas, pears). You could also try a small pasta like macaroni. Rice is very, very messy. Steamed vegies until they are very soft. Sultanas.
 
If your bub is fine with bread you could try muffins.
